The Demons Haven'T Won

Battling demons in the dark
Behind the light of a smile

Hoping to find a precious spark
To make the fight worthwhile 

Evading the relentless attack
Coming in wave after wave

Trying hard not to crack
Your existence is there to save

Life outside is a blur
There is nothing clear to see 

Desperately seeking the spur
To find the energy to flee

Loved ones don't know of the struggle
Or of the warfare in your head

Of the pressure of trying to juggle
Between happiness and dread

Although the conflict carries on 
The demons haven't won

Your passion hasn't gone
Exhausted, but you are not done
